Driver arrested in Sittingbourne after banging is heard inside lorry

A lorry driver has been arrested on suspicion of immigration offences after his vehicle was stopped by police.

Police stopped the lorry in a car park off Mill Way, Sittingbourne (pictured)

The 43-year-old was pulled over yesterday following reports of banging heard coming from inside his vehicle.

The incident happened on the Trinity Trading Estate near Mill Way, Sittingbourne, at around 12.30pm.

A police spokesman said: "We attended and arrested [him] on suspicion of assisting illegal entry into the UK."
